On Guardion's LLM vulnerability Benchmark, Meta Llama 3H 405B is the more secure of the two: Kimi K2-Thinking-0905 scores 38.0% and Llama 3H 405B scores 36.6% on attack success rate (ASR) (lower is better). One or both scores are estimated from public safety evaluations pending a Guardion benchmark run.

What is the attack success rate (ASR) of Kimi K2-Thinking-0905 vs Llama 3H 405B?

Kimi K2-Thinking-0905 has a 38.0% ASR and Llama 3H 405B has a 36.6% ASR — the share of adversarial prompts that succeed across zero-shot, TAP, and Crescendo attacks. Lower is safer.

How were Kimi K2-Thinking-0905 and Llama 3H 405B tested?

Both were red-teamed with the HarmBench framework across zero-shot, TAP (Tree of Attacks with Pruning), and Crescendo multi-turn attacks, scored by Attack Success Rate.
